    Abstract: Various embodiments include a method for controlling an energy exchange among a plurality of energy systems using a control center, wherein a component of one of the plurality of energy systems is coupled to the control center via an interface module for data exchange. The method includes: transmitting a first data set to the interface module with a prediction profile regarding an energy exchange of the component; transmitting a second data set to the control center using the interface module including the first data set and component-specific data of the component; determining control data using the control center using the prediction profile and the component-specific data and data communicated to the control center by further energy systems to determine the control data; transmitting the determined control data to the interface module; and operating the component based on the control data.

    Abstract: Various embodiments include a method for controlling load flows between multiple energy systems via an electrical grid using a control apparatus common to the energy systems. Each of the energy systems can provide a power associated with a load flow at a grid node. The method may include: ascertaining first powers scheduled for the load flows using data from the energy systems, including information about a maximum power providable at the respective grid node by the respective energy system; determining an internal controlling power to the electrical grid and resolved with respect to the grid nodes on the basis of the ascertained scheduled first powers and grid boundary conditions provided for the electrical grid; taking account of the controlling power determined at the grid node by reducing or increasing the maximum powers providable at that grid node by the energy systems; ascertaining scheduled second powers on the basis of the reduced or increased maximum providable powers; and controlling the load flows according to the ascertained second powers.

    Abstract: Various embodiments include methods for controlling energy conversion, energy storage, energy transportation, and/or energy consumption of multiple energy installations of an energy system and/or of multiple consumers flexible with regard to their load. The method may include: optimizing values of variables for control by calculation based on a first and a second optimization variable; calculating multiple solutions of the values optimum with regard to the first optimization variable, using a first optimization; ascertaining one of the calculated solutions as optimum with regard to the second optimization variable using a second optimization; and using the optimum calculated solution for controlling the energy system.
